#6869E1 Hex Color Code

#6869E1

The Hexadecimal Color #6869E1 is a contrast shade of Medium Slate Blue. #6869E1 RGB value is rgb(104, 105, 225). RGB Color Model of #6869E1 consists of 40% red, 41% green and 88% blue. HSL color Mode of #6869E1 has 240°(degrees) Hue, 67% Saturation and 65% Lightness. #6869E1 color has an wavelength of 468.88889n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#6869E1 is #9999F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#6869E1 is #66D. The Closest Color to #6869E1 is #7B68EE. Official Name of #6869E1 Hex Code is Moody Blue.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#6869E1 is 54 Cyan 53 Magenta 0 Yellow 12 Black and #6869E1 CMY is 54, 53,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#6869E1 is hsl(240,67,65,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(240, 54, 88).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#6869E1 is 24.35, 18.48, 73.5.
Hex8 Value of #6869E1 is #6869E1FF. Decimal Value of #6869E1 is 6842849 and Octal Value of #6869E1 is 32064741. Binary Value of #6869E1 is 1101000, 1101001, 11100001 and Android of #6869E1 is 4285032929 / 0xff6869e1.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#6869E1 is 0.209, 0.159, 0.159 and YIQ Color Space of #6869E1 is 118.381, -39.1519, 37.1325.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#6869E1 is 13.85, 14.69, 72.6.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#6869E1 is 50.07, 32.76, -61.52.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#6869E1 is 50.07, -7.33, -97.49.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#6869E1 is 50.07, 69.7, 298.04. Hunter Lab variable of #6869E1 is 42.99, 25.88, -71.28.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#6869E1

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
